Yorkies, like all Terriers, were bred to hunt and kill vermin all on their own. As in, go down the hole where the rat (or whatever) lived, and fight and kill it. Without necessarily getting any help from a human. When a dog breed has been bred for that, then being stubborn, hard to convince, and downright mean is part of the job description!
(Dachshunds were bred to go down badger holes and kill badgers. Explains alot about Dachsies
) They tend to be diggers too. Especially when they're bored or otherwise not supervised.
They're supposed to be "scrappy". Some people apparently like that in a dog
They're "yappy" so that if a human is helping the human can find them underground, dig them up, and help.
